Hellas Verona won the Serie A Week 27 against Sassuolo on Sunday 3 March 2024 at the Marc’Antonio Bentegodi Stadium in Verona, Italy. Tough debut for Sassuolo Coach Mister Ballardini, his first on the black-green bench, with a defeat. The first goal in Serie A for Karol Swiderski and it is a very heavy goal, because not only gave the victory to Hellas Verona on 23 points, but it also allows them to put three points between themselves and Sassuolo (still stuck on 20), as well as catch up with Frosinone.
In the next round, Hellas Verona will be involved in another lunch match against Lecce scheduled for Sunday 10 March 2024. Sassuolo will instead find their friendly fans at the Mapei Stadium, hosting Frosinone on Saturday 9 March.
Hellas Verona opened the score in the 79th minute. Karol Swiderski defeated Sassuolo goalkeeper Andrea Consigli with a left-footed shot to the bottom right corner. The assist is by Federico Bonazzoli

✅ Stats before the game: Only two of the 17 matches in Serie A between Verona and Sassuolo ended in a draw: one with a score of 1-1, on 20 December 2015, and another which ended 3-3 on 28 June 2020 – six victories for the Scaligeri complete the picture and nine of the neroverdi. After the 3-1 success in the first leg, Sassuolo could beat Verona in both seasonal matches in Serie A for only the second time, after having done so in 2020/21, with the two teams led respectively by Roberto De Zerbi and Ivan Juric. Last season, Verona found victory at home against Sassuolo in Serie A (2-1, 8 April 2023), after suffering four home defeats in a row with an aggregate score of 2-7. Verona have lost two of the three matches (1W) played in this championship against teams who started the day in the last four positions in the standings and one of the two defeats came against Sassuolo in the first leg (1-3). Sassuolo is coming off five consecutive away defeats in Serie A, in which they conceded 12 goals and scored only two; the neroverdi have never recorded six knockouts in a row away from home in their history in the top flight.
